Rugby round-up: Wins for Bedwas and Hafodyrynys on quiet weekend

The international break meant most sides had a weekend off

Most sides across Caerphilly County Borough had a weekend off with Wales in action, but there were still some crucial ties at play as the season nears its conclusion.

Just the one borough side in Premiership action over the weekend, Cross Keys suffered a 43-31 loss to league leaders Pontypridd and stay in fifth.

Bedwas were in action one division below and built on their win last weekend with a comfortable 36-14 victory over Treorchy.

A case of Déjà vu for Ynysddu in the same division, who for the second week in a row were shut out, this time 55-0 on the road to Beddau.

Not many games elsewhere due to international rugby, but Hafodyrynys were in action down in League Five East where they claimed a 32-7 win over Magor.
